Mr.Yogendra Kumar Singh 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E SUDHIR SINGH ORAL ORDER 16-05-2019 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ned APP for the State.

The petitioner seeks bail in a case instituted for the offences under Sections 302/34 of the Indian Penal Code. The prosecution case in short is that the bhagina of the informant went along with the accused persons from his house and later his dead body was found.

It has been submitted on behalf of the petitioner that the petitioner is in custody since 2.9.2018 and has got no criminal antecedent. There is no allegation of tampering of witnesses alleged against the petitioner. Charge-sheet has been submitted in the present case. There is no eye witness to the alleged occurrence. The brother of the petitioner was seen lastly

Patna High Court CR. MISC. No.32253 of 2019(2) dt.16-05-2019 2/2 with the victim. The petitioner has been made accused in the present case as being brother of co-accused Ajay Choudhary. Except for this, there is no substantive evidence to suggest the implication of the petitioner in the present case. On behalf of the State, it is submitted that the petitioner is named in the F.I.R.

Considering the aforesaid facts and circumstances, it is directed that the petitioner, above named, be released on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s.10,000/- (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ned A.C.J.M. Sasaram in connection with Nokha P.S. Case No. 237 of 2018.
